What is Invisalign?

Invisalign is an orthodontic treatment that uses clear, removable aligners to straighten teeth gradually. Unlike traditional braces, Invisalign is nearly invisible, meaning that most people won’t even know you’re wearing them. In addition, Invisalign aligners are comfortable and easy to clean, making them a popular choice for adults and teens.

How does Invisalign Treatment work?

Invisalign treatment consists of a series of clear, custom-made aligners that you wear over your teeth. These aligners gradually move your teeth into the desired position based on the treatment plan created by your Invisalign provider. You wear each set for about two weeks before being replaced with the next set in the series. Invisalign treatment typically takes 9-18 months to complete, though this can vary depending on the individual case.

You’ll need to schedule a consultation with an Invisalign near you to get started with Invisalign treatment. During this consultation, your Invisalign provider will assess your teeth and bite to determine whether Invisalign is right for you. If Invisalign is the best treatment option, your provider will create a treatment plan and take impressions of your teeth, creating your custom Invisalign aligners.

What are the benefits of Invisalign?

Invisalign offers many benefits over traditional braces, making it an attractive option for many people considering orthodontic treatment. Some of the benefits of Invisalign include the following:

  1. Invisibility: Invisalign aligners are nearly invisible, meaning that most people won’t even know you’re wearing them. It can be a major advantage for adults self-conscious about wearing braces.
  2. Comfort: Invisalign aligners contain a smooth, comfortable material that won’t irritate your gums or cheeks like metal braces.
  3. Removability: Invisalign aligners can be removed for eating, drinking, brushing, and flossing.

How to Clean Invisalign?

It is important to clean your aligners daily to maintain optimal oral hygiene during Invisalign treatment. The best way to clean Invisalign aligners is to brush them with a soft-bristled toothbrush and gentle toothpaste. You can also use Invisalign cleaning crystals or special Invisalign cleaning tablets designed to remove plaque and bacteria from your aligners. It is also important to rinse your Invisalign aligners with lukewarm water before putting them back in your mouth. Finally, regularly visit your dentist or orthodontist near you for professional cleanings and check-ups.
